Clubhouse Report
January 2026
Reporting Period December 1 – December 31, 2025
During this period, the Clubhouse hosted 11 meals and 1 dance, generating $13,922 in revenue with $8,556 in expenses,
resulting in a net gain of $5,366. Food costs continue to be closely monitored, and meal pricing will be adjusted as needed throughout the season.
We are preparing for a busy second half of the 2025–2026 season. Our first Buddy Beer event will be held on
Monday, January 19, with Prime Rib Sliders available for purchase.

Construction Report
January 2026
Reporting Period December 1 – December 31, 2025
During this reporting period, a total of 21 permit applications were submitted. All were approved.
All improvements residents make contributes to the overall appearance and quality of the park.
Please remember that a permit is required for any modifications to the exterior of a unit. An
orange CPOA permit must be visibly posted from the street before work begins and must remain
posted until the project is completed.
Thank you for helping to maintain and enhance our community!
Compliance
January 2026
Reporting Period December 1 – December 31, 2025
During this reporting period, a total of 39 compliance violations were issued. Of these, 38 were
warnings. A total of $600 fines were assessed. with $500 attributed to a single owner who
continues to receive a weekly pet-related fine.
As noted in the Caliente Rules & Regulations, house numbers must be prominently
displayed on the front of each unit, including RVs, using large, preferably luminous, numerals.
As a reminder, all actionable complaints must be submitted in writing. Verbal or informal
complaints cannot be processed, as they are considered hearsay.
We will continue to emphasize this policy to ensure fairness and consistency in addressing
resident concerns.
